Four monitoring functions (estimate_avg_q_value_with_early_stopping,
collect_qvalue_statistics, compute_q_gap_for_epoch, compute_per_action_q_values)
iterated over batch_sample.experiences to build CPU tensors for forward passes.
When GPU PER (GpuPrioritized) is active, experiences is always vec![] — all data
lives on GPU tensors in gpu_batch. This created zero-element tensors with non-zero
shapes, triggering CUBLAS_STATUS_INVALID_VALUE on the next forward pass.
Fix: all four functions now check for gpu_batch.states and use it directly,
falling back to CPU experiences only for non-GPU buffers. Also removes debug
eprintln probes, wires new_on_device for DQN/RegimeConditionalDQN construction,
and adds GPU-aware smoke tests (33 pass, 874 total, 0 failures).
